Council Apologises For Street Numbering Error

Bass Coast Shire Council has issued an apology to 35 residents of Glen Alvie Road who have been advised of incorrect house numbers assigned to their properties.

By Bass Coast Shire Council - 2nd May 2006 - Back to News

Council’s Chief Executive Officer, Allan Bawden, said during the road renaming, odd and even numbers were assigned to the wrong sides of the road through human error.

"35 residents would have received a letter advising them of a new house number due to the renaming of part of Grantville-Glen Alvie Road to Glen Alvie Road.

"The mistake is being rectified and new letters advising land owners of the correct numbers will be issued this week.

"We sincerely apologise for any inconvenience caused and will review our procedures to ensure this type of error will not happen again," advised Mr Bawden.
